    Most of the Rolls OHV area seems to be cleared from the fire last year, no real issues with pinstripes or anything (minus the wrong turn I made...) This is the trail we took:
    35DEFC43-A817-47BE-B37D-75428CFD897F.jpg

    Would say a lift is needed, but we were able to do everything in 2wd, up until where the ridge heads down to the coves. I went down, then saw @Bob_Wiley waiting at the top. He made a good choice, since I had to use 4HI to get back up.
